SubdivideQuads Struct Reference

#include <VolumeToMesh.h>

Public Member Functions

 SubdivideQuads (PolygonPoolList &polygons, const std::unique_ptr< openvdb::Vec3s[]> &points, size_t pointCount, std::unique_ptr< openvdb::Vec3s[]> &centroids, std::unique_ptr< unsigned[]> &numQuadsToDivide, std::unique_ptr< unsigned[]> &centroidOffsets)
void operator() (const tbb::blocked_range< size_t > &range) const

Constructor & Destructor Documentation

SubdivideQuads ( PolygonPoolList polygons,
const std::unique_ptr< openvdb::Vec3s[]> &  points,
size_t  pointCount,
std::unique_ptr< openvdb::Vec3s[]> &  centroids,
std::unique_ptr< unsigned[]> &  numQuadsToDivide,
std::unique_ptr< unsigned[]> &  centroidOffsets 

Member Function Documentation

void operator() ( const tbb::blocked_range< size_t > &  range) const

